Visa Consulting and Analytics (VCA) is the consulting arm of Visa, and drives tangible, impactful results for clients. Drawing on our expertise in consulting, data analytics, technology, payments and economics, VCA solves the most strategic problems for our clients. VCA's core client segments include issuers, acquirers, merchants, fintechs, payment enablers and governments.
Within VCA exists VCA Implementation Services (VIS), a hands-on execution partner, implementing, operating, and optimizing Visa products in client environments to accelerate activation, portfolio growth, risk control, and data-driven performance.
